The mitochondria is the "powerhouse of the cell" as it generates most of the cell's supply of adenosine triphosphate (ATP) through the process of cellular respiration.
The process of respiration primarily occurs in the mitochondria of cells, specifically in the inner membrane where the electron transport chain and ATP synthesis take place. Some steps of respiration also occur in the cytoplasm of the cell, such as glycolysis.
Aerobic respiration takes place in the mitochondria of the cell. This process involves the breakdown of glucose molecules to produce energy in the form of ATP. Oxygen is required for this process to occur efficiently.
Mitochondria are not necessary for the process of diffusion to occur. Diffusion is a passive transport mechanism that allows molecules to move from an area of higher concentration to an area of lower concentration, driven by concentration gradients. This process does not require energy or cellular organelles like mitochondria. However, mitochondria are crucial for cellular respiration and energy production, which can influence other cellular processes.
